WebJan 31, 2024 · Crypto fair market value is converted to dollars for tax purposes. Cryptocurrency is generally treated as property. All property-transaction taxes apply to crypto transactions. Wages paid in cryptocurrency are taxed as regular income. Self-employment income paid in cryptocurrency is taxed as regular self-employment income.
